+static int load_aiff_and_send_headers(demux_aiff_t *this) {
+
+ unsigned char preamble[PREAMBLE_SIZE];
+ unsigned int chunk_type;
+ unsigned int chunk_size;
+ unsigned char buffer[100];
+
+ pthread_mutex_lock(&this->mutex);
+
+ this->video_fifo = this->xine->video_fifo;
+ this->audio_fifo = this->xine->audio_fifo;
+
+ this->status = DEMUX_OK;
+
+ /* audio type is PCM unless proven otherwise */
+ this->audio_type = BUF_AUDIO_LPCM_BE;
+ this->audio_frames = 0;
+ this->audio_channels = 0;
+ this->audio_bits = 0;
+ this->audio_sample_rate = 0;
+ this->audio_bytes_per_second = 0;
+
+ /* skip past the file header and traverse the chunks */
+ this->input->seek(this->input, 12, SEEK_SET);
+ while (1) {
+ if (this->input->read(this->input, preamble, PREAMBLE_SIZE) !=
+ PREAMBLE_SIZE) {
+ this->status = DEMUX_FINISHED;
+ pthread_mutex_lock(&this->mutex);
+ return DEMUX_CANNOT_HANDLE;
+ }
+ chunk_type = BE_32(&preamble[0]);
+ chunk_size = BE_32(&preamble[4]);
+
+ if (chunk_type == COMM_TAG) {
+ if (this->input->read(this->input, buffer, chunk_size) !=
+ chunk_size) {
+ this->status = DEMUX_FINISHED;
+ pthread_mutex_lock(&this->mutex);
+ return DEMUX_CANNOT_HANDLE;
+ }
+
+ this->audio_channels = BE_16(&buffer[0]);
+ this->audio_frames = BE_32(&buffer[2]);
+ this->audio_bits = BE_16(&buffer[6]);
+ this->audio_sample_rate = BE_16(&buffer[0x0A]);
+ this->audio_bytes_per_second = this->audio_channels *
+ (this->audio_bits / 8) * this->audio_sample_rate;
+
+ } else if ((chunk_type == SSND_TAG) ||
+ (chunk_type == APCM_TAG)) {
+
+ /* audio data has been located; proceed to demux loop after
+ * skipping 8 more bytes (2 more 4-byte numbers) */
+ this->input->seek(this->input, 8, SEEK_CUR);
+ this->data_start = this->input->get_current_pos(this->input);
+ this->data_size = this->audio_frames * this->audio_channels *
+ (this->audio_bits / 8);
+ this->running_time = this->audio_frames / this->audio_sample_rate;
+ this->data_end = this->data_start + this->data_size;
+
+ this->audio_block_align = PCM_BLOCK_ALIGN;
+
+ break;
+
+ } else {
+ /* unrecognized; skip it */
+ this->input->seek(this->input, chunk_size, SEEK_CUR);
+ }
+ }
+
+ /* the audio parameters should have been set at this point */
+ if (!this->audio_channels) {
+ this->status = DEMUX_FINISHED;
+ pthread_mutex_lock(&this->mutex);
+ return DEMUX_CANNOT_HANDLE;
+ }
+
+ /* load stream information */
+ this->xine->stream_info[XINE_STREAM_INFO_AUDIO_CHANNELS] =
+ this->audio_channels;
+ this->xine->stream_info[XINE_STREAM_INFO_AUDIO_SAMPLERATE] =
+ this->audio_sample_rate;
+ this->xine->stream_info[XINE_STREAM_INFO_AUDIO_BITS] =
+ this->audio_bits;
+
+ xine_demux_control_headers_done (this->xine);
+
+ pthread_mutex_unlock (&this->mutex);
+
+ return DEMUX_CAN_HANDLE;
+}
